Spiny Rock Oyster

Saccostrea echinata

Spiny Rock Oyster

This rock oyster cements itself to pier pilings, rocks and coastal hard surfaces, common across intertidal shores. It even settles onto mariculture cages as part of the fouling community, filtering plankton from the water through its rough spiny shell.

Taxonomy: Animalia › Mollusca › Bivalvia › Ostreida › Ostreidae › Saccostrea
